Thank you very much! -Maxim Ian Dowse wrote: > In message <20050326160107.GA92727@www.portaone.com>, Maxim Sobolev writes: > >>Please note that when I take ehci out of kernel those devices are >>attached before root fs is mounted. If it can help I can send you >>dmesg without ehci. > > > Ah, for directly connected low/full speed devices I guess we need > to do the ehci explore in order to hand the port over to the companion > controller. > > Below is a possible solution to this. Alternatively even just > changing the usb_coldexplist TAILQ_INSERT_TAIL to a TAILQ_INSERT_HEAD > would probably do the trick. > > Let me know if this helps. > > Thanks, > > Ian > > Index: usb.c > =================================================================== > RCS file: /dump/FreeBSD-CVS/src/sys/dev/usb/usb.c,v > retrieving revision 1.105 > diff -u -r1.105 usb.c > --- usb.c 19 Mar 2005 19:27:38 -0000 1.105 > +++ usb.c 26 Mar 2005 16:33:37 -0000 > @@ -301,8 +301,14 @@ > * the keyboard will not work until after cold boot. > */ > #if defined(__FreeBSD__) > - if (cold) > - TAILQ_INSERT_TAIL(&usb_coldexplist, sc, sc_coldexplist); > + if (cold) { > + /* Explore high-speed busses now, but defer others. */ > + if (speed == USB_SPEED_HIGH) > + dev->hub->explore(sc->sc_bus->root_hub); > + else > + TAILQ_INSERT_TAIL(&usb_coldexplist, sc, > + sc_coldexplist); > + } > #else > if (cold && (sc->sc_dev.dv_cfdata->cf_flags & 1)) > dev->hub->explore(sc->sc_bus->root_hub); > @@ -952,7 +958,7 @@ > sc->sc_port.device = NULL; > } > > -/* Explore all USB busses at the end of device configuration. */ > +/* Explore USB busses at the end of device configuration. */ > Static void > usb_cold_explore(void *arg) > { > > >
